LGBTQ+ Couples Therapy That Goes Beyond Affirmation

Being affirming is the starting point, not the selling point. You should never have to explain your relationship structure, justify your identity, or educate your therapist about your experience. At Solid Foundations, you will not need to.

Our queer affirming therapists understand the unique relational dynamics of same-sex partnerships, queer relationships, and the full spectrum of LGBTQ+ identities. They understand how minority stress affects relationship functioning, how internalized messages about identity can show up in conflict, and how the coming out process continues to evolve throughout a relationship. You will work with a therapist who already has the context. So you can focus on the work.

What LGBTQ+ Couples Therapy at Solid Foundations Looks Like

Your first session is a structured intake. Your therapist will ask about your relationship history, what brought you to therapy, and what you want to be different. You will set specific goals together. Questions your therapist may ask include: How do you each identify? What are the main areas of tension in your relationship right now? How long has this been going on? What have you already tried? Who in your life knows about and supports your relationship?

From that first conversation, your therapist will build a focused, personalized action plan. It will serve as the roadmap for your work together. Every weekly session will teach you a specific skill or strategy aimed directly at the goals you identified. You will not spend sessions venting without direction. You will leave each session with something concrete to practice.

Session ends with specific skills and homework to practice before the next one. You will not leave sessions without a clear action. We believe change happens between sessions as much as in them.

Most same sex couples begin to notice meaningful shifts within eight to twelve sessions, Though fully meeting your goals will likely take longer. The work requires commitment: weekly attendance, real effort between sessions, and willingness to look honestly at your own patterns alongside your partner's.
